Northern Portugal is a region rich in culture, history, and natural beauty. Whether you're a history buff, a food lover, or a fan of scenic landscapes, the north offers something for everyone. Here are the top 5 most visited cities in Northern Portugal you shouldn't miss:




1. Porto

As Portugal's second-largest city, Porto is known for its charming old town, iconic Dom Luís I Bridge, and world-famous port wine. A walk through the Ribeira district offers a glimpse into the city's vibrant soul, with colorful buildings, riverside cafes, and lively street performances. 2. Braga

Often referred to as the "Rome of Portugal," Braga is one of the oldest cities in the country. Its baroque churches, Roman ruins, and the famous Bom Jesus do Monte sanctuary make it a spiritual and architectural gem. 3. Guimarães

Known as the birthplace of Portugal, Guimarães is steeped in medieval charm. Its well-preserved castle, ancient streets, and UNESCO World Heritage historic center provide a time-travel experience like no other.





4. Viana do Castelo

Situated by the Atlantic Ocean and the mouth of the Lima River, Viana do Castelo is perfect for those who appreciate both coastal charm and mountain views. The city is also a hub for traditional Portuguese festivals and craftsmanship.



5. Douro Valley (Peso da Régua / Pinhão)

Though technically a region rather than a city, towns like Peso da Régua and Pinhão in the Douro Valley are must-visits for wine lovers.
